Pokemon legends Arceus leaks have become a hot topic since its worldwide release on 28 January 2022, where around 12 million video game copies have been sold. Remember that Pokemon legend Arceus is an action role-playing game developed by Game Frege and published by Nintendo and Pokemon Company. Pokemon Arceus was first announced last year in the event of the Pokemon Game Series’ 25th anniversary.
This edition is based on the ideology of a hero who is sent back through time as they move from the Hisui constituency on the Hokkaido islands at the time of initial Japanese colonization. Pokemon Arceus revolves around exploring the region’s various open areas inhabited by Pokémon. The game’s objective is to finish a list of Pokédex, i.e., Pokémon in the region.

SPECULATIONS REGARDING POKEMON LEGEND ARCEUS DLC
According to recent Pokemon Arceus leaks, there will be a total of 400 DLC in the Pokemon, not to mention the addition of mega evolutions to Pokemon Legends shortly.
Although nothing has yet been confirmed by the company but conferring to rumours, there will be an additional 158 Pokemon to reach the count of 400. These Pokemon Arceus leaks include new forms of “Dialga and Palka, a Hisuian electrode line, new starter evolution,” and many more.
These leaks can be trusted as they have provided 100% correct information except that new Pokemon Legendary forms are “Origin” rather than “Primal.” Since these leaks seem correct, their claim regarding Arceus DLC can be trusted if the company refrains from sharing the data with us.
